Kohima, July 25 (MExN): Sixteen students from the Ao community were conferred with the 16th N.I. Jamir Academic Excellence Award for securing Top 20 in HSLC examination conducted by Nagaland Board of School Education (NBSE) 2022 at Merhulietsa, Kohima on July 23.

A press note stated here that speaking on the occasion, Minister for Higher Education, Tribal Affairs, Temjen Imna Along said, ‘our state is on the top list in literacy rate in the country but sadly top listed among the unemployment state.’ He exhorted the students to pursue their career with passion to fit in this world of Artificial Intelligent. 

The welcome speech was delivered by Jongpongtoshi, President, Kohima Ongpangkong Telongjem. On behalf of the trust board, Imtiakum give a short speech and Dr Ralimongla delivered a thanks note on behalf of N.I. Jamir family members.
